Director General’s office

The Director General is the chief executive officer and legal representative of EMBL, and is responsible for overall leadership, strategic direction and management of the organisation.

The Director General is supported by the Directorate and Extended Directorate, comprising leadership representatives from across EMBL sites and functions.

Reporting to EMBL Council, the Director General is responsible for the development of the overall policy and strategy, and for establishing consensus around EMBL’s five-year programme.

The Director General guides the evolution of EMBL’s role, missions and programmes to best serve the needs of the scientific community and of broader European society, and thus achieve EMBL’s full potential to support the life sciences in Europe for the benefit of all stakeholders.

The Director General provides intellectual leadership for the multidisciplinary and international community of EMBL staff and fellows, and has overall responsibility for EMBL’s day-to-day operations and the performance of all parts of the organization, with the assistance of the senior management team.

The Director General is the spokesperson for EMBL and serves as an advocate and communicator with all stakeholders and interested parties including the scientific community, policy makers, industry groups, funding organizations, the media and the general public.

As of 31 March 2026, Anthony Hyman is the Director General for the European Molecular Biology Laboratory.
